易截截图软件、单文件、免安装、纯绿色、仅160KB

PL/SQL DEVELOPER 基本用法详解(转)

PL/SQL DEVELOPER 基本用法详解(建议写过第一个存储过程后的初手必读)
  
用过oracle的都抱怨,为了稳定 它提供的图形化操作 速度慢的让人伤心呀,p4+128M的机器只要启动一个
  
oracle服务就够让人伤心的,再在dba studio里面操作真能让人哭。
  pl/sql developer正是解决这个问题的:功能强,方便,快。用了之后绝对离不开它!
它的主要强项如下:
  
一.编辑表数据(浏览表数数据自然不在话下)
二.在sql plus下写长的语句时是否有些心烦,在这里一样搞定。
三.写存储过程,并调试。如果世界上没有sql/plus dev,真不知道怎么调试几百行的存储过程。说这种情况效
  
率提高了十倍绝不为过吧。
  
下面具体说明:
一。左边的浏览窗口选择 tables ,会列出所有的表,选择表右击鼠标选中菜单"Edit Data",右边会有一个新
  
的窗口,列出表的所有数据。
看表的数据上方有个工具条,图标分别为“锁形”,“增加(+)”,“删除(-)”,“保存(勾形)”。
修改数据后怎么提交修改呢?
1.点“勾形”,保存数据。
2.看工具栏的第二栏,有两个好东东,图标不好描述哈,你把鼠标放在这两个按钮图标上,会显示“
  
commit(F10)","rollback(shift+F10)" 。commit就提交数据修改了,点之。
ok?^_^  dba studio里面好像不能粘贴复制数据,这里想怎么copy就怎么copy^_^
  
二。 new ->command window ->相当于sql plus,用起来当然比sql plus爽。
  
三。存储过程
所用函数说明
功能:求和与差
原形:GetSumAndSub(p1 in number , p2 in number ,m out number , b out number)   
参数:m=p1+p2  b=p1-p2
  
1.先建存储过程  
左边的浏览窗口选择 procedures ,会列出所有的存储过程,右击文件夹procedures单击菜单“new",弹出
  
template wizard窗口, name框中输入 GetSumAndSub ,parameters中填入: p1 in number , p2 in number ,m  
  
out number , b out number  。单击ok,右边出现建立存储过程的代码窗口。其中内容为创建存储过程的语句
  

在begin end 之间输入具体内容,最后如下;
create o


相关文档:

LINQ to Entities 实现sql 关键字"In"方式总结

在LINQ to Entities中没有办法再像 LINQ to SQL 中一样使用 Contains 的方法来实现sql "in" 关键字
下面代码在 LINQ to SQL 中可行 在LINQ to Entities却无法运行: 
var s = db.Account.Select(c => c.ID);
var ret =(from t in db.Profile
 where&n ......

LINQ to SQL 性能 10 Tips


LINQ to SQL 性能 10 Tips
http://www.cnblogs.com/worksguo/archive/2008/06/04/1213075.html
前一周,我的硬盘有两分区坏了,我准备的文章与资料都在里面,所以LINQ的文章停了一段时间,真的太不好拉,为来弥补一下就先发这篇文章上拉,明天再一篇关于Disconnection Data的文章。
只不过幸好,在这几天中我竭尽全力 ......

SQL时间函数详解

1. 当前系统日期、时间
select getdate() 
2. dateadd 在向指定日期加上一段时间的基础上,返回新的 datetime 值
例如:向日期加上2天
select dateadd(day,2,'2004-10-15') --返回:2004-10-17 00:00:00.000
3. datediff 返回跨两个指定日期的日期和时间 ......

数据库命名规范(适用SQL Server)

设计原则
 
符号三大范式(每一列表达一个意思,每一行代表一个实例/每一行有唯一键/表内没有其它表的非主键信息)
 
每个表应该有的3个有用字段(记录创建或更新时间/记录创建者/记录版本)
 
避免保留字
 
表应避免可为空的列


 
命名规范
 

表名如Or ......

SQL 2000 Insert返回自动编号id三种方法比较


SQL Server 2000中,insert数据的时候返回自动编号的id,有三种方法实现SCOPE_IDENTITY、IDENT_CURRENT 和 @@IDENTITY,它们都返回插入到 IDENTITY 列中的值。
IDENT_CURRENT :返回为任何会话和任何作用域中的特定表最后生成的标识值。IDENT_CURRENT 不受作用域和会话的限制,而受限于指定的表。IDENT_CURRENT 返回为任 ......
© 2009 ej38.com All Rights Reserved. 关于E健网联系我们 | 站点地图 | 赣ICP备09004571号